Subject:
CD writer problem
Category: Computers > Hardware Asked by: peter1961-ga List Price: $4.00 |
Posted:
23 Nov 2004 12:38 PST
Expires: 24 Nov 2004 14:09 PST Question ID: 433018 |
The internal CD writer in my Windows XP PC has just stopped working. It reads OK but it will not write. I have tried different media and even a different CD writer but the problem is the same. I have tried all the usual things like checking to see that the cables are properly inserted. |

Subject:
Re: CD writer problem
From: stamos-ga on 23 Nov 2004 16:53 PST |
It seems as if you've done all the necessary hardware inspections and based on the fact that it is reading media. I would suspect the burning software at this point; therefore, the most expedient panacea (if in fact is the source) is to simply reinstall it, and i, too, would recommend visiting the manf.'s web site for any patches, i.e., updates related to windows XP. Subject:
Re: CD writer problem
From: peter1961-ga on 24 Nov 2004 14:09 PST |
Thanks. I have been able to fix the problem as the printer also stopped working at the same time but it had worked only the day before. This reminded me I have used some PC "unwanted files" cleaning software. When I restored the files the problem was solved for the printer and CDR. Thanks Regards Peter |
